Dongguk University and CNTTECH Recruit 13th Class for Startup CEO and Investment Associate Course
CNTTECH announced on July 31 that it is recruiting the 13th class of students for the 'Startup CEO and Investment Associate Course with CNTTECH,' which is jointly operated with Dongguk University.
This is a hands-on education program aimed at those looking to enhance their expertise in the fields of entrepreneurship and investment, including prospective entrepreneurs, startup founders, aspiring investment associates, and open innovation managers from corporations.
The 13th batch will cover a curriculum based on real cases, focusing on the startup investment process, company valuation, investment contract practices, investment approaches of accelerators (AC) and venture capitalists (VC), strategies for utilizing the TIPS and government support programs, how to draft and deliver IR pitches, and practical training for investment reviews. It will also provide opportunities for fundraising and business cooperation through networking between investors and entrepreneurs.
The program is conducted with a practical approach, utilizing CNTTECH's actual investment cases and Dongguk University's systematic education system. Participants will have the opportunity to learn from the experiences shared by current AC and VC investors and successful entrepreneurs.
Jeon Hwaseong, CEO of CNTTECH and the chief professor, said, "This course is a practical education program designed to enable entrepreneurs and investors to understand each other's perspectives and grow together. It is meaningful in nurturing the next generation of leaders who will drive the startup ecosystem in Korea."

The recruitment for the 13th class will be open until August 26. Successful applicants will be announced on August 27. Tuition payment is scheduled from August 27 to September 2, and the program will begin on September 3.
